Real Local Reviews From Verified Customers

Libertyville, IL 60048
Distance: 18.9 mi.
Schaumburg, IL 60173
Distance: 18.9 mi.
4.6 out of 5
5925 Reviews
Libertyville, IL 60048
Distance: 19 mi.
Libertyville, IL 60048
Distance: 19.3 mi.
Antioch, IL 60002
Distance: 19.6 mi.
Antioch, IL 60002
Distance: 19.7 mi.
Gurnee, IL 60031
Distance: 19.7 mi.
Antioch, IL 60002
Distance: 19.7 mi.
Gurnee, IL 60031
Distance: 19.7 mi.
Schaumburg, IL 60173
Distance: 19.9 mi.
Schaumburg, IL 60173
Distance: 19.9 mi.
Schaumburg, IL 60193
Distance: 19.9 mi.
Harvard, IL 60033
Distance: 20.1 mi.
Buffalo Grove, IL 60089
Distance: 20.1 mi.